Resumo: Free radicals consume electrons from other adjacent molecules, altered and compromising the structures of these molecules, causing oxidation and premature aging. Several diseases are associated with oxidative stress, such as Parkinson's disease, Alzheimer's, atherosclerosis. In view of the diversity of the Brazilian flora, the present sought to address through the literature studies on the antioxidant capacity of native Brazilian species. To this end, 15 studies selected from primary research sources were analyzed. The selected studies pointed out that species such as Anadenanthera peregrina and Plinia cauliflora represent an alternative in obtaining antioxidant compounds, due to the presence of phenolic compounds. Further studies are needed to extract and isolate these compounds to apply in the pharmaceutical and cosmetic industry safely.
